## Release Checklist — Bounce Processor

- Confirm suppression list writes are idempotent.
- Verify webhook signatures rejected on mismatch.
- Check no raw recipient data in logs.
- Rerun fuzz suite on parser.

Security reviewer signs off only against the exact artifact. The reviewed build's token follows.

pipeline stamp: htk31_f769b577b3028a4e9958e5bb8d1259a

To the release manager: I'm passing ownership of the Pellwick deep-link router to Sorrel before the 4.2 cut. The intent-matching table now lives in the Farrowgate config service; stale entries were purged last sprint. Watch the fallback route — it silently swallows malformed slugs, which inflated our drop-off metrics in March. The staging resolver needs its keystore unlocked before each regression pass, and that keystore accepts only one credential. For the signing vault, the recovery phrase is noted directly below.

recovery phrase for tafog-fafog: novix-novdor-fraath-brieth-olieth-oliix-rusix-wenion-julax-druox

The renewal of our three-year agreement with Torvane Materials has been assessed in detail. Proposed terms include a 4.2% unit-price increase, partially offset by improved volume rebates and extended payment terms of sixty days. Sensitivity analysis indicates a net annual cost impact of under 1% on the Meridia product line, assuming stable demand. Legal has flagged no material changes to liability clauses. We recommend approval, subject to the conditions outlined in the confidential note below.

confidential, yawip-bahif: Zorokox Partners plans to lower the Casax list price by 28.0 percent in April. The board signed off on a budget of $271.0 million for Project Juldor. The renewal with Pelokox Partners closes at $410.1 million a year, 3.4 percent below the last contract. Project Pelok slips by a full year because of the audit delay.